Summary

We are planning a 5-day backpacking trip in SW Yellowstone from near Old Faithful to Bechler Ranger Station. Our permit is for 4 people so we are looking for 1 or 2 experienced backpackers with a vehicle since this is a point to point trip.
We will camp near the Shoshone Geyser Basin the first night. The second and fourth night will be near a couple of the few soakable hot springs in the park. The hikes range from 5-8 miles per day with a total of about 33 intermediate to strenuous miles. On reaching Bechler, we’ll drive to Old Faithful to pick up the second vehicle and perhaps have a goodbye drink.
